DEFINITIONS OF TERMS AND CONSTRUCTION ------------------------------------- 1.1 Definitions. Unless a different meaning is plainly implied by the ----------- context, the following terms as used in this Agreement shall have the following meanings: (a) "Beneficiary" shall mean such person or persons designated pursuant to Section 4.2 hereof to receive benefits after the death of the Eligible Director. (b) "Board of Directors" shall mean the Board of Directors of MSIF and the Board of Directors of MSUF. (c) "Code" shall mean the Internal Revenue Code of 1986, as amended from time to time, or any successor statute. (d) "Compensation" shall mean the amount of directors' fees paid by each of MSIF and MSUF to the Eligible Director during a Deferral Year prior to reduction for Compensation Deferrals made under this Agreement. (e) "Compensation Deferral" shall mean the amount or amounts of the Eligible Director's Compensation deferred under the provisions of Section 3 of this Agreement. (f) "Deferral Accounts" shall mean the accounts maintained to reflect the Eligible Director's Compensation Deferrals made pursuant to Section 3 hereof and any other credits or debits thereto. (g) "Deferral Year" shall mean each calendar year, or the period beginning on the effective date of this Agreement and ending on December 31 of the calendar year which contains the effective date, during which the Eligible Director makes, or is entitled to make, Compensation Deferrals under Section 3 hereof. (h) "Eligible Director" shall mean a member of the Board of Directors who is not an "affiliated person," as such term is defined under Section 2(a)(3) of the Investment Company Act of 1940, as amended (the "1940 Act"). (i) "Hardship and Unforeseeable Emergency" shall mean a severe financial hardship to an Eligible Director resulting from a sudden and unexpected illness or accident of the Eligible Director or a dependent (within the meaning of Section 152(a) of the Code) of the Eligible Director, loss of the Eligible Director's property due to casualty, or other similar extraordinary and unforeseeable circumstances, arising from events beyond the Eligible Director's control. Whether circumstances constitute a Hardship and Unforeseeable Emergency depends on the facts of each case, as determined by each of MSIF and MSUF, but in any case does not include a hardship that may be relieved: (i) through reimbursement or compensation by insurance or otherwise; (ii) by liquidation of the Eligible Director's assets to the extent that liquidation itself would not cause such a severe financial hardship; or (iii) by ceasing to defer receipt of any Compensation not yet earned. The need to send an Eligible Director's child to college and the desire to purchase a home shall not constitute a Hardship and Unforeseeable Emergency. (j) "Money Market Series" shall mean a series of MSIF or MSUF that values its securities in accordance with Rule 2a-7 under the 1940 Act. (k) "Separation from Service" shall mean the date on which the Eligible Director ceases to be a member of a Board of Directors. PERIOD DURING WHICH COMPENSATION DEFERRALS ARE PERMITTED -------------------------------------------------------- 2.1 Commencement of Compensation Deferrals. The Eligible Director may -------------------------------------- elect, on a form provided by and submitted to each of the President of MSIF and the President of MSUF, to commence Compensation Deferrals under Section 3 hereof for the period beginning on the later of (i) the date this Agreement is executed or (ii) the date such form is submitted to the President of MSIF or MSUF. 2.2 Termination of Deferrals. With respect to each of MSIF and MSUF, the ------------------------ Eligible Director shall not be eligible to make Compensation Deferrals after the earlier of the following dates: (a) His Separation from Service as an Eligible Director of MSIF or MSUF; or (b) The effective date of the termination of this Agreement. 3. COMPENSATION DEFERRALS ---------------------- 3.1 Compensation Deferral Elections. ------------------------------- (a) Prior to the effective date of this Agreement, and for subsequent Deferral Years prior to the first day of any Deferral Year, the Eligible Director may elect, on the form described in Section 2.1 hereof, to defer the receipt of all or a portion of his Compensation which he is entitled to receive from each of MSIF and MSUF during such Deferral Year. Such writing shall set forth the amount of such Compensation Deferral in whole percentage amounts and the investment return designation provided for under Section 3.3 hereof. Such election shall continue in effect for all subsequent Deferral Years unless it is canceled or modified as provided below. (b) Compensation Deferrals shall be withheld from each payment of Compensation by each of MSIF and MSUF to the Eligible Director based upon the percentage amounts elected by the Eligible Director under Section 3.1(a) hereof. (c) The Eligible Director may cancel or modify the amount of his Compensation Deferrals for each of MSIF and MSUF on a prospective basis by submitting to each of the Presidents of MSIF and MSUF a revised Compensation Deferral election form. Such change will be effective as of the first day of the Deferral Year following the date such revision is submitted to each of the Presidents of MSIF and MSUF. (d) No Compensation Deferrals shall be permitted with respect to Compensation payable by a Money Market Series of MSUF. 3.2 Valuation of Deferral Account. ----------------------------- (a) MSIF and MSUF shall each establish, as necessary, one or more Deferral Accounts to which will be credited an amount equal to the Eligible Director's Compensation Deferrals under this Agreement. Compensation Deferrals shall be allocated to the Deferral Accounts on the first business day following the date such Compensation Deferrals are withheld from the Eligible Director's Compensation. The Deferral Accounts shall be debited to reflect any distributions from such Accounts. Such debits shall be allocated to the Deferral Accounts as of the date such distributions are made. (b) As of each Valuation Date, income, gain and loss equivalents (determined as if the Deferral Accounts are invested in the manner set forth under Section 3.3, below) attributable to the period following the next preceding Valuation Date shall be credited to and/or deducted from the Eligible Director's Deferral Accounts. (c) The Eligible Director's Deferral Accounts may be maintained in the form of a bookkeeping entry only, and neither MSIF nor MSUF shall be required to fund the Deferral Accounts. 3.3 Return on Deferral Account Balance. ---------------------------------- (a) (i) For purposes of measuring the investment return on Compensation Deferrals, the Eligible Director may elect to have the aggregate amount of his Compensation Deferrals for each of MSIF and MSUF receive a return (i) at a rate equal to the prevailing rate applicable to 90-day U.S. Treasury Bills at the beginning of each calendar quarter for which this rate is in effect, or (ii) at a rate of return (positive or negative) equal to the rate of return on shares of any of the series of MSIF or MSUF, assuming reinvestment of dividends and distributions, provided, however, that Compensation Deferrals attributable to a Money Market Series of MSIF will automatically receive a return at a rate equal to the rate of return on the shares of the Money Market Series to which such Compensation Deferrals are attributable. Provided, however, such designation by the Eligible Director is not binding on the President of MSIF or the President of MSUF, but is expected to be followed at all times. (ii) The Eligible Director shall make a designation of investment return for each of MSIF and MSUF on a form provided by the Presidents of MSIF and MSUF, which designation shall remain effective until another valid designation has been made by the Eligible Director as herein provided. The Eligible Director as of the end of each calendar quarter may amend his designation of investment return for each of MSIF and MSUF by giving a subsequent written designation as described above at least 30 days prior to the end of such calendar quarter. A timely change to an Eligible Director's designation of investment return shall become effective with respect to MSIF and MSUF on the first day of the calendar quarter beginning at least 30 days following receipt by the President of MSIF and the President of MSUF, respectively. (iii) Each of the Presidents of MSIF and MSUF, in their sole discretion, may change or add to the investment alternatives which may be designated by the Eligible Director under this Section 3.3(a). (b) Except as provided below, the Eligible Director's Deferral Accounts shall receive a return in accordance with his investment designations, provided such designations conform to the provisions of this Section. However, if: (i) the Eligible Director does not furnish the President of MSIF or the President of MSUF with a written designation; (ii) the written designation from the Eligible Director is unclear; or (iii) less than all of the Eligible Director's Deferral Accounts are covered by such written designation, then the Eligible Director's Deferral Account shall receive a return designated by the President of MSIF or MSUF, as applicable, in his sole discretion until such time as the Eligible Director shall provide other instructions in accordance with the terms of this Agreement. MSIF and MSUF shall provide an annual statement(s) to the Eligible Director showing such information as is appropriate, including the aggregate amount in the Deferral Accounts, as of a reasonably current date. 4. DISTRIBUTIONS FROM DEFERRAL ACCOUNTS ------------------------------------ 4.1 In General. Distributions from the Eligible Director's Deferral ---------- Accounts shall be paid in cash, in generally equal annual installments over a period of five (5) years beginning on the first day of the year following the year of his Separation from Service, except that the Board of Directors of each of MSIF and MSUF, in its sole discretion, may accelerate or extend the distribution of such Deferral Accounts. Notwithstanding the foregoing, in the event of the liquidation, dissolution or winding up of MSIF or MSUF or the distribution of all or substantially all of the assets and property of MSIF or MSUF relating to one or more series of its shares to the shareholders of such series (for this purpose a sale, conveyance or transfer of MSIF's or MSUF's assets to a trust, partnership, association or corporation in exchange for cash, shares or other securities with the transfer being made subject to, or with the assumption by the transferee of, the liabilities of MSIF or MSUF shall not be deemed a termination of MSIF or MSUF or such a distribution), all unpaid amounts in the affected Deferral Accounts as of the effective date thereof shall be paid in a lump sum on such effective date. 4.2 Death Prior to Complete Distribution of Deferral Accounts. Upon the --------------------------------------------------------- death of the Eligible Director prior to the commencement of the distribution of the amounts credited to his Deferral Accounts, the balance of such Deferral Accounts shall be distributed to his Beneficiary in a lump sum as soon as practicable after the Eligible Director's death. In the event of the death of the Eligible Director after the commencement of such distribution, but prior to the complete distribution of his Deferral Accounts, the balance of the amounts credited to his Deferral Accounts shall be distributed to his Beneficiary over the remaining period during which such amounts were distributable to the Eligible Director under Section 4.1 hereof. Notwithstanding the above, the Board of Directors of each of MSIF and MSUF, in its sole discretion, may accelerate or extend the distribution of the Deferral Accounts. 4.3 Hardship and Unforeseeable Emergency. An Eligible Director may ------------------------------------ request at any time a withdrawal of part or all of the amount then credited to his Deferral Accounts on account of Hardship and Unforeseeable Emergency by submitting a written request to MSIF or MSUF accompanied by evidence that his financial condition constitutes a Hardship and Unforeseeable Emergency. MSIF and MSUF shall review the Eligible Director's request and determine the extent, if any, to which such request is justified. Any such withdrawal shall be limited to an amount reasonably necessary to meet the Hardship and Unforeseeable Emergency, but not more than the amount of benefit to which the Eligible Director would be entitled upon his Separation from Service. 4.4 Designation of Beneficiary. For the purposes of Section 4.2 hereof, -------------------------- the Eligible Director's Beneficiary shall be the person or persons so designated by the Eligible Director in a written instrument submitted to each of the Presidents of MSIF and MSUF. In the event the Eligible Director fails to properly designate a Beneficiary, his Beneficiary shall be the person or persons in the first of the following classes of successive preference surviving at the death of the Eligible Director: the Eligible Director's (1) surviving spouse or (2) estate. 4.5 Payments Due Missing Persons. Each of MSIF and MSUF shall make a ---------------------------- reasonable effort to locate all persons entitled to benefits under this Agreement. However, notwithstanding any provisions of this Agreement to the contrary, if, after a period of five (5) years from the date such benefit shall be due, any such persons entitled to benefits have not been located, their rights under this Agreement shall stand suspended. Before this provision becomes operative, each of MSIF and MSUF shall send a certified letter to all such persons to their last known address advising them that their benefits under this Agreement shall be suspended. Any such suspended amounts shall be held by MSIF and MSUF for a period of three (3) additional years (or a total of eight (8) years from the time the benefits first become payable) and thereafter, if unclaimed, such amounts shall be forfeited. 5. MISCELLANEOUS ------------- 6.1 Rights of Creditors. ------------------- (a) This Agreement is unfunded. Neither the Eligible Director nor any other persons shall have any interest in any specific asset or assets of MSIF or MSUF by reason of any Deferral Accounts hereunder, nor any rights to receive distribution of any Deferral Accounts except and to the extent expressly provided hereunder. Neither MSIF nor MSUF shall be required to purchase, hold or dispose of any investments pursuant to this Agreement; however, if in order to cover its obligations hereunder MSIF or MSUF elects to purchase any investments, the same shall continue for all purposes to be a part of the general assets and property of MSIF or MSUF, subject to the claims of its general creditors and no person other than MSIF or MSUF shall by virtue of the provisions of this Agreement have any interest in such assets other than an interest as a general creditor. (b) The rights of the Eligible Director and the Beneficiaries to the amounts held in the Deferral Accounts are unsecured and shall be subject to the creditors of MSIF and MSUF, as applicable. With respect to the payment of amounts held in the Deferral Accounts, the Eligible Director and his Beneficiaries have the status of unsecured creditors of each of MSIF and MSUF, as applicable.
